Other [Other]March Monthly Boosting Thread
Hello, and welcome to this month’s boosting thread!
First and foremost, start by reading the comments to see if another Redditor has requested some help. If that’s the case, reach out and get a session organized! This will help lower the number of comment threads all revolving around the same game.
If nobody has requested help for your game, feel free to make a comment. We’d like for you to include in your comment the name of the game/trophy you’re boosting, how many players you’re looking for, what time zone you’re in, and a preferable way for reaching out to organize a boosting session. Our hope is that by having you coordinate in PM’s or some other fashion, this will sidestep a lot of scrolling people will have to do in order to find a boosting group.
Finally, if you manage to fill a group, please edit your comment to say “Group Full”. That way, someone else can create a new boosting thread if necessary.
We want everybody who needs help to receive it, and we can ensure that by eliminating coordinating comment threads and keeping things nice and tidy. Please be mindful, and understand that boosting threads are first come first serve.

[Monster Hunter Wilds] #106: It is a great game but I am a bit disappointed with it.
Monster Hunter World is my favorite game so I had very high expectations on Wilds. I thought it would be a life changing experience for me like how World was. The game is good but did not meet them. It does not have as much content as I expected.
The Platinum was very easy for a Monster Hunter game. World and Iceborne took me around 1200 hours, Rise and Subreak took around 900 hours but Wilds took only 100 hours.
